Black Diamond Therapeutics reported Q1 2026 EPS of -$0.16, beating analyst estimates of -$0.1884 by 15.07%. The company recorded no revenue for the quarter, consistent with its pre-commercial stage. Despite the earnings beat, shares fell sharply by 35.77%, likely reflecting broader market concerns over clinical timelines and cash runway.

Black Diamond Therapeutics,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ing small-molecule cancer therapies, reported no revenue for Q1 2026, as expected given its pre-revenue status. Operating expenses remained the primary driver of cash burn, with R&D costs and G&A expenses driving the net loss of $0.16 per share. The EPS beat was driven by disciplined expense management rather than any revenue generation. Key operational highlights include progress in the company’s lead program, BDTX-1535, a novel EGFR inhibitor aimed at non-small cell lung cancer. Management has emphasized data readouts from ongoing Phase 2 trials, which may provide critical efficacy and safety signals. The company’s cash position and burn rate remain under close scrutiny by investors, as insufficient liquidity could force dilutive financing. The 35.77% stock decline suggests that the market is more focused on these operational risks than the modest earnings surprise.

Management did not provide formal guidance for future quarters, consistent with typical practice for pre-commercial biotechs. However, the company expects to report key clinical data from its BDTX-1535 program later this year, which could serve as a major catalyst. Strategic priorities include advancing the pipeline while managing cash burn to extend the runway into critical data readouts. Black Diamond may also explore partnership opportunities to share development costs or secure non-dilutive funding. Risk factors include potential delays in trial enrollment, unfavorable data outcomes, and the need for additional capital. The company anticipates that its current cash resources will fund operations into mid-2026, though this timeline could shift depending on trial progress and spending decisions. Any setback in clinical milestones could further pressure the stock and increase the likelihood of dilutive financing. Investors should monitor upcoming investor conferences and regulatory interactions for updates on trial timelines.

The 35.77% drop in BDTX shares following the Q1 report suggests that the market’s primary concern is the company’s path to value creation, not the minor EPS beat. Analyst commentary has been mixed; some firms highlight the potential of BDTX-1535 in a competitive EGFR landscape, while others caution about the high cash burn and lack of near-term revenue catalysts. The stock’s reaction implies that investors are assigning a low probability to positive trial outcomes in the near term. Key catalysts to watch include the release of initial Phase 2 data for BDTX-1535 and any announcements regarding strategic partnerships or financing. The company may also provide updates on its preclinical pipeline and expansion into additional indications. For now, the stock remains highly speculative, and price volatility is likely to continue as clinical milestones approach. The EPS beat, while positive, appears insufficient to shift sentiment without evidence of clinical progress.
